(v1.49) X-Priority: 3 (Normal) Message-ID: <75112397993.20030611021134@aka-root.com> To: freebsd-security@freebsd.org Mime-Version: 1.0 Content-Type: text/plain; charset=us-ascii Content-Transfer-Encoding: 7bit Subject: user can't member more than 15 group X-BeenThere: freebsd-security@freebsd.org X-Mailman-Version: 2.1.1 Precedence: list Reply-To: Mitch List-Id: Security issues [members-only posting] List-Unsubscribe: , List-Archive: List-Post: List-Help: List-Subscribe: , X-List-Received-Date: Tue, 10 Jun 2003 23:09:46 -0000 Hello All ! why freebd user can't member more than 15 group ? my system is FreeBSD 4.8-RC I need that scripts running from user "master" make some changes if files that owned by other users. Shurely i can set UID of master to "0" but this increace vunerability of system. in /etc/group I add user1:*:1001:master ... user15:*:1015:master --- all work Ok user master member of all user1-user15 groups (this user "master" with ID!=0 , in server polisy reasons, must have additional right for access to fises that belong user1 - userXX, if 775/664 right set to files) but if i add user16:*:1016:master user "master" not member of user16 group until i remove it from any other groups == it can not write to files that onned by user16:user16 and rights 664/775 I search in LINT but can not find anyone according to increase GROUP LIMIT :( Best regards, Mitch mailto:security@aka-root.com
